Posted inEntertainment News TV & Streaming
Stranger Things Finale: Eleven’s Sacrifice Ends the Upside Down
At a Glance
Stranger's Things ends after 5 seasons in 2025.
Finale sees Eleven sacrifice herself to close the Upside Down.
Fans rate the ending...




